Patna: Once again, a case of huge sums of money coming into a person's bank account from Bihar has come to light. This news from Khagaria, then Katihar, and now Muzaffarpur has surprised people. People were stunned by the sudden arrival of 52 crores in the bank account of an elderly person. Actually, this matter has come to light from the Katra police station area of ​​Muzaffarpur district. Where Ram Bahadur Shah had reached a CSP operator to check the amount of his old age pension.

However, as soon as he put his thumb to get the account checked, the CSP operator was surprised, as more than Rs 52 crore was deposited in the account of the elderly Ram Bahadur. Soon it spread like a forest fire throughout the area. When media persons rushed to the spot to enquire about the matter, Ram Bahadur said that he had approached the nearest CSP operator with an old-age pension. Where the CSP operator said that more than Rs 52 crore has come into his account. Everyone was stunned to hear where such a huge amount of money came from. Ram Bahadur himself works as a farmer, and he was surprised to see such a huge amount.

On the other hand, Sub Inspector Manoj Pandey of Katra police station said that we have received this information through local people and media. More than Rs 52 crore has been inscribed in the bank account of a man from Singari. We will follow the orders of the senior officers in the case. It is currently under investigation. 960 crores have also come into the accounts of two school children of Katihar earlier.
